Luke 1:6
New American Standard Bible 1995
6 They were both (A)righteous in the sight of God, walking (B)blamelessly in all the commandments and requirements of the Lord.

Luke 1:6
New International Version
6 Both of them were righteous in the sight of God, observing all the Lord’s commands and decrees blamelessly.(A)
Romans 2:26
New American Standard Bible 1995
26 (A)So if (B)the [a]uncircumcised man (C)keeps the requirements of the Law, will not his uncircumcision be regarded as circumcision?

Romans 2:26
New International Version
26 So then, if those who are not circumcised keep the law’s requirements,(A) will they not be regarded as though they were circumcised?(B)
